Pricing Plans

Free Trial

Free

Free

  • 1 user
  • 1 project
  • 100 MB storage
  • Basic features

Basic

$10/month

  • 5 users
  • 5 projects
  • 1 GB storage
  • Advanced features

Pro

$25/month

  • Unlimited users
  • Unlimited projects
  • 10 GB storage
  • All features
  • Priority support

How DX1 Compares to Competitors

Compared to Asana, which starts at $10.99/user/month for basic features, DX1's "Pro" tier at $25/month for unlimited users is significantly more cost-effective. Trello's premium plans also typically charge per user, making DX1's unlimited user offering a strong contender for value.

DX1 Pricing FAQ

How much does DX1 cost?

DX1 starts at $10/month on the Basic plan. It offers 2 paid tiers ranging from $10/month up to $25/month. A free plan is also available with limited features.

Does DX1 have a free plan?

Yes. DX1 offers a free plan called "Free". It includes: 1 user, 1 project, 100 MB storage.

Does DX1 offer a free trial?

Yes, DX1 offers a free trial. No credit card is typically required to start the trial, though this may vary.

What is the cheapest DX1 paid plan?

The cheapest paid plan for DX1 is "Basic" at $10/month. Key features include: 5 users, 5 projects, 1 GB storage.
